The vibrant sheen of solar panels transforming sunlight into sustainable energy hides a grim reality lurking within the global supply chains. As the world races to harness renewable energy, whispers of forced labor in China’s solar panel manufacturing sector grow louder, casting a shadow over the industry’s seemingly virtuous mission.
Amid China’s rapid strides in solar panel production—accounting for a staggering 77.8% of global output—alarm bells are ringing about the ethical costs behind this dominance. The heart of the controversy is the Xinjiang Uyghur Autonomous Region, where disturbing allegations have emerged regarding the use of forced labor among the Uyghur minorities and other predominantly Muslim ethnic groups. The United Nations, alongside other influential bodies, has documented these human rights infractions, adding credibility to the claims.
The United States and several European nations have taken steps to tackle this issue, blocking shipments and enforcing legislation aimed at reducing reliance on unethical sources. Yet, despite the international outcry, many countries, eager to propel their green energy transitions, risk turning a blind eye, prioritizing renewable goals over rigorous human rights adherence.
Polysilicon, a critical material for solar panels, is often at the epicenter of these concerns. Nearly half of the world’s solar-grade polysilicon is produced in Xinjiang, and investigations have linked its production to forced labor practices. Such revelations challenge businesses and governments to scrutinize their supply chains more diligently.
While countries like the United States enforce stringent measures to mitigate such risks, others appear to navigate a delicate balance between ethical procurement and energy necessities. In the United Kingdom, debates rage over regulatory rollbacks that critics argue could ease the importation of tainted solar components.
This complex interplay of ethical considerations and urgent environmental goals underscores the profound challenge facing the renewable energy sector today. Understanding the Controversy: Forced Labor in Solar Panel Production
The controversy centers around allegations of forced labor in the Xinjiang Uyghur Autonomous Region, a significant hub for solar panel production. This area is responsible for producing nearly half of the world’s solar-grade polysilicon, a key material for solar panels. Overwhelming evidence of forced labor practices among Uyghur minorities has been documented by the United Nations and other reputable bodies, raising serious ethical concerns about the solar supply chain.
Global Response and Ethical Dilemmas
Countries are responding to these revelations through legislation and trade regulations. The United States, for instance, has implemented stringent import restrictions and laws aimed at curbing reliance on products tied to forced labor. However, some nations find themselves in a precarious situation, wanting to meet renewable energy targets without exacerbating ethical breaches.
In the United Kingdom, efforts to relax import regulations have been met with criticism, as stakeholders fear this could inadvertently support unethical practices. This reflects the broader dilemma faced worldwide: balancing urgent environmental goals with strict adherence to human rights principles.
Strengthening Ethical Supply Chains
How to Ensure Ethical Sourcing:
1. Research Suppliers: Companies should thoroughly vet their suppliers for ethical labor practices. This includes adherence to international labor standards.
2. Demand Transparency: Push for transparency in the supply chain. Companies should demand audits and documentation that confirm ethical production practices.
3. Support Legislation: Advocate for and adhere to laws that mandate due diligence in supply chains to avoid human rights abuses.
4. Leverage Technology: Use technology like blockchain to trace and verify the source of materials used in solar panels.
5. Engage Stakeholders: Collaborate with NGOs, governments, and other companies to pressure high-risk areas into implementing ethical practices.

Challenges and Limitations
1. Verification Difficulties: Tracking the exact origins of materials can be challenging due to the complexity of global supply chains.
2. Regulatory Variability: Different countries have different standards and regulations, making a unified global approach difficult to implement.
3. Economic Impact: Strict regulations might lead to increased costs, which could slow down the adoption of solar power.
